FIBA Approves October 15, 2026 For New NBBF Elections

World’s basketball governing body, FIBA, has directed that elections to constitute a new board for the Nigeria Basketball Federation, should be held not later than October 15, 2026.

In the official letter signed by its Secretary General, Andreas Zaglis, and addressed to NBBF President Engr. Ahmadu Musa Kida, FIBA acknowledged receipts of petitions from various stakeholders regarding the governance of the Nigeria Basketball Federation (NBBF) and the timing of its upcoming elections.

It reads in parts ‘As you are aware, since 2017 FIBA has closely monitored the governance issues of NBBF, which tend to become contentious during the election year.

‘Four years ago, these issues led to the withdrawal of your women’s national team from the FIBA Women’s Basketball World Cup and obliged FIBA to impose a disciplinary sanction on NBBF. It took FIBA ‘s intervention for the eventual normalisation of the situation in October 2022.’

Having considered the documentation on file, as well as previous experience, FIBA states;

(A) FIBA recognizes the current NBBF Board’s mandate until 15 October, 2026

(b) Elections for the NBBF governing bodies must take place after the conclusion of the FIBA Women’s Basketball World Cup (13 September 2026) and by no later than 16 October 2026, the newly elected NBBF Board shall start its mandate.

(c) FIBA will not recognize any amendments to the NBBF Statutes before the electoral process is completed. Therefore, the upcoming elections must be conducted under the current statutory framework and in compliance with the FIBA General Statutes and Internal Regulations.
